WebSo your FERS retirement pension is determined by three factors, your High-3 Salary, your Years of Creditable Service and your Pension Multiplier. For most FERS, their pension multiplier is 1%. Having … WebMar 18, 2024 · To be eligible to retire with an immediate retirement, FERS employees must meet one of the following: Age 62 and 5 years of service. Age 60 and 20 years of service. Minimum Retirement Age (Between age 55-57) and 30 years of service. The good news is that for retirement eligibility purposes, it does not matter if your years of service are full ...

Step 2: apply percent calculated in Step 1 to High-3 average pay. 26.4% * $65,000 = $17, 160 gross annual pension.
